Basis's biggest appeal is consolidation — managing search, social, and programmatic from one dashboard. For agencies that are stretched thin and want to reduce tool sprawl, that's genuinely useful. Their workflow tools and pacing features are solid for teams without dedicated traders.
But consolidation comes at a cost. Basis's programmatic capabilities aren't as deep as a dedicated DSP — their CTV access is limited, their SSP footprint is smaller, and they don't offer the RTB-level transparency that agencies need to prove value to clients. And like every other platform in the category, they keep all the margin. DSP Connect gives it back.
When Basis makes sense
Basis is the right fit for agencies that need to manage search and paid social alongside programmatic, and don't want to juggle multiple platforms to do it. If your team is small and efficiency matters more than programmatic depth or margin expansion, Basis's unified workflow is a legitimate advantage.
